> I hope Paul won't mind if I change his solution:
>
> Instead of his last line:
>
> do(?"c:\program files\firefox15\firefox.exe",
> ?"http://dict.leo.org/?search="++clip.get
> <http://dict.leo.org/?search=> )
>
> This works when I tested it:
>
> do(?"c:\program files\firefox15\firefox.exe",
> ?"http://dict.leo.org/?search="++clip.get)
>
> Note:
> That must be only one line in the "Enter more commands..."
> box. Yahoo adds a Return character [CR/LF] when it breaks a
> long line in our messages. That is called hard word wrap
> instead of soft word wrap.
>
> You only want a space character after the comma,
> so you have to delete the CR/LF which Yahoo adds.
> To be sure, you can paste it into Notepad, then make it only
> one line. Then copy it and paste it into the PP dialog.
>
> When you paste that long line into "Enter more commands"
> it will look like two lines, but really it is only one line
> which is soft wrapped by PowerPro - so there is no Return
> character after the comma.
